Bitcoin Trilogy#1 - Digital Gold Rush, The Bitcoin Odyssey

In the digital age, the new gold isn't found in the earth, but in the code that weaves our future.

This trilogy, measuring 60x60 cm each, captures the essence of Bitcoin, drawing parallels to the historic gold rush. It delves into key moments like the halving, spotlighting the anticipation and speculation it fuels. Satoshi Nakamoto, Bitcoin's enigmatic creator, represents the elusive fortune seekers of old. The series also underscores Bitcoin's secure, encrypted foundation, mirroring the protective measures of gold reserves. Together, these pieces narrate the adventurous pursuit of digital wealth in our modern era.
